Practical Publisher Notes for Implementation
Before committing this asset to a live website, run through these essential checks. They ensure your final content looks polished and functions well.
- Test Across Devices: Preview how it looks on desktop and mobile screens, especially as a tiny thumbnail.
- Preview in Layout: Place it inside a real blog article draft alongside your headline and body text.
- Check Typography Pairing: Test it with different font styles—a serif font for a traditional feel, a sans-serif for modernity, or even a display font for extra impact.
- Assess Readability: Ensure any text you overlay has sufficient contrast against the design elements.
- Review Technical Specs: Confirm the file size is web-optimized; compress images properly to maintain site performance.
- Verify Licensing: Always confirm the commercial license terms before using it on monetized websites, affiliate pages, or within paid digital products like eBooks.
